Were still moving along, but slower than planned. Weve averaged less than our target of 60 to 65 kilometers a day because weve had to walk, instead of run, through blocks of ice heaved upon Lake Baikals suce. There are stretches when we can run relatively clear and free, but its just not possible around ice piles because wed break our sleds if we tried.
